On 12 July 2005, CGH became the second hospital in Singapore to receive the prestigious international Joint Commission International (JCI) accreditation. This accreditation recognises the hospital’s performance in complying with international health care quality standards from the American-based Joint Commission on Accreditation of Healthcare Organizations (JCAHO). It demonstrates our commitment to improving quality, ensuring a safe environment for, and reducing risks to patients and staff.
Continuing the quality journey to meet international standards in clinical quality and patient safety, CGH was re-accredited by JCI in April 2008 and April 2011.
In 2007, CGH’s Heart Failure Programme and Acute Myocardial Infarction Programme also received the stamp of approval from JCI. We are the first hospital in the world to have two JCI certified programmes in cardiac care, and the first hospital in Singapore to receive JCI Disease-Specific Care certification for our care programmes. This is testament to the quality of our programmes, showing that they are on par with international standards for similar disease management programmes. Both programmes were re-accredited in 2010. |
